Rumba hip movements are exaggerated and therefore are a result of excellent system: foot, ankle, knee and leg motion.
The Tango music fashion is considerably repetitive with its marching top quality, and phrasing in Tango is crucial.
Bolero, the slowest Latin Dance, expresses the matured like of a seasoned pair that has endured its romance, portraying unison and energy.
Tango is noted for its certain footwork and apparent top. Because the leader takes strolling actions ahead, the toes articulate via rolling the foot heel to toe.
Time period when dancing grew to become widespread might be traced on the 3rd millennia BC, when Egyptians started off applying dance as integral pieces of their spiritual ceremonies. Judging by the many tomb paintings that survived the tooth of time, Egyptian priests employed musical instruments and dancers to mimic critical gatherings - stories of gods and cosmic patterns of moving stars and sun.
